US Corteva Agriscience Sets up in Casablanca its African Regional Hub

Corteva Agriscience, Agriculture Division of DowDuPont, has decided to install its North-West & West Central Africa regional headquarters in Casablanca, Morocco. US Spending Legislation Incorporates Sahara; Morocco Applauds

President Donald Trump on Friday signed into law the 2019 appropriation legislation that stipulates explicitly that the assistance funds allocated to Morocco will also benefit the Sahara. Morocco welcomed the text, which recognizes Morocco’s sovereignty over its Sahara southern provinces, as it is unequivocally pro-Morocco and unusually forthcoming on US development funds for the Sahara. French Le Piston to set up second air industry plant in Morocco

Le Piston, a French company manufacturing airplane and helicopter parts, will set up its second plant in Morocco for a total investment of €5 million, Moroccan media said. Casablanca Finance City Joins Efforts with Abu Dhabi Global Market

Casablanca Finance City (CFC) and Abu Dhabi Global Market have agreed to enhance cooperation and jointly promote the development of financial services in Morocco and the United Arab Emirates.
